Most stunning wedding dresses from New York Bridal Fashion Week 2019
Showcased designers include well-known names such as Vera Wang and Monique Lhuillier
The New York Bridal Week Fall 2019 has just lowered its curtains. Time-honoured labels like Vera Wang, Elie Saab and Carolina Herrera, as well as rising designers such as Monique Lhuillier, presented fanciful collections for brides-to-be to dream about when they walk down the aisle.
Here are our top picks from the semi-annual event to fall in love with, whether you’re planning a wedding or not.
Vera Wang
Vera Wang is the bridal queen who has designed gowns for celebrities including Ivanka Trump, Kim Kardashian, Sofia Vergara, and, most recently, Barbara Bush, daughter of former US president George W. Bush.
Inspired by King Louis XIV who was enthusiastic about clothes, the collection had a soft and warm colour palette, finished with golden detailing and red velvet belts. The designer underscored the regal style with weighty accessories like crowns and chunky Gothic earrings.
Tadashi Shoji
Inspired by the brides themselves, Tadashi Shoji’s autumn 2019 bridal collection highlighted simple silhouettes and royal elegance. Crafted from lighthearted tulle fabric, a series of airy gowns with tea length-hemlines and blush pink, laurel-leaf embellishment yield lightness and delicacy.
Exquisite details such as fitted sleeves, Watteau trains, lace-trimmed veils, matt sequins, iridescent cording complemented the sophisticated embroidery.
Monique Lhuillier

Filipino-American fashion designer Monique Lhuillier entered the bridal business as a bride-to-be planning for her own wedding. She couldn’t find anything she liked on the market, so she created her own dress.
Her business swiftly took off after Britney Spears wore her gown to her 2004 wedding, followed by Reese Witherspoon donning a blush strapless dress marrying Jim Toth in 2011. The designer’s ready-to-wear but couture-quality designs are also favoured by celebrities including Blake Lively, Gwyneth Paltrow, Taylor Swift to Michelle Obama and Melania Trump.

The designer constructed a sensual garden for her new collection. Bold floral patterns are printed on silk organza and tulle fabric, in contrast with metallic, three-dimensional and jewelled elements. Capes, jackets, cathedral-length trains and streamers are crafted from floral lace with an abstract palette of sunset, peony and rose gold.
Viktor & Rolf

Founded by Dutch designers Viktor Horsting and Rolf Snoeren, Viktor & Rolf is known for its avant-garde designs from wedding gowns to ready-to-wear collections.

For the autumn 2019 bridal designs, the duo pushed brides into a different realm: pantsuits, frothy sleeves, high-waist shirt dresses as well minis. The collection is for bold and courageous brides-to-be.
The collection includes a vintage A-line gown with an open cross-back, petite bow detailing and deep V-neck, matched with a scarf-style veil wrapped around the model’s head in 1920s style.
The wide use of lace and satin matching structures and 3D floral patterns added a feminine touch to the design-oriented gowns.
